If you are a new driver or maybe just received authority as an owner-operator, understanding what deadhead is can be critical when searching for the right load. Deadhead in trucking is when a truck driver is driving with an empty trailer. Not necessarily.

Trucking deadhead can be extremely dangerous for truck drivers. Trucks with an empty trailer weigh half as much as full ones. This can be problematic if a trucker is driving through an area with especially high winds. Not only can an empty trailer sway around and be difficult to control, it can flip open, causing serious injury.
Be sure to always check the weather reports and wind conditions before heading out to pick up a load with an empty trailer. Trucklo is a free load board connecting carriers with shippers.
